Abstract :
The authentication of web service combination is the key to ensure the normal working of the combination service. Many methods of current web service combination are half-formalization, which can come out many errors and not easy to be detected, so the correctness is hard to be ensured. The paper introduces the Transfer matrix to analyze the deadlock problem in web service combination, and adopt Incidence matrix to ensure the accessibility of combination. Fuzzy Reasoning Petri net is the reasoning method of formalization authentication, which can achieve the credibility authentication, credibility and accessibility of the service combination. The result of the experiment show the method is an good authentication method.
